The was launched in 2010 to collect donations of new holiday gifts and books for teens, a group that is typically underserved in community toy programs.

 As the co-founders of T4T, we would like to thank the Los Gatos community for their generosity again this year, which translated into hundreds of new books and holiday gifts for teens. 

We served approximately 200 teens in 2010, but this year the program was able to brighten the holidays for more than 400 teens!

The need was doubly great this year but with the giving nature of our community, we were able to meet this need

Gifts were collected at Fisher Middle School, Los Gatos High School, Los Gatos Chamber of Commerce, Affordable Treasures, Los Gatos Roasting Company, Starbucks, Jamba Juice, and (in Campbell) through Dec. 16, and cash donations were used to purchase additional age appropriate gifts and books for the 11-18 year old age group.

Gifts were distributed this year to families registering with the or West Valley Community Services.

Heartfelt thanks to all of the teens and families who donated wonderful gifts, cash, and/or time to help make this happen. With the help of individual volunteers. businesses such as Whole Foods, the Sereno Group, Camp BizSmart, JJ Magoo’s, The Wooden Horse, Barnes & Noble and Drs. Hall and Burnett, as well as volunteer clubs such as the Kiwanis, Fisher Builder’s Club and Los Gatos High School Key Club and Interact Club, this was truly a community effort. 

Whether you brought reusable bags to Whole Foods every week, liked us on Facebook, dined at JJ Magoo’s, donated cash when having your gifts wrapped or while at Farmer’s Market, donated gifts, or volunteered your time, so many found a way to make a difference. 

Treasures 4 Teens is grateful to each of you who shared your holiday spirit and supported this program. Teens in our area really are treasured!

Michael and Giverny Daboll, Los Gatos residents
